WebThe Wake. This chapter situates the wake as the conceptual frame for living blackness in the diaspora in the still unfolding aftermaths of Atlantic chattel slavery. WebChapter One, “The Wake,” descri bes Sharp e’s methodology, as well as the family deaths that inuenced her decision to partake in “wake work.” Chapter Two, “The Ship,” examines the genealogy of a slave ship, from the occupants on the ship to the construction of the ship to the remnants that the ship leaves behind.
